An observant teacher can make a real difference in a child’s life. Teachers can play a critical role in preventing and reducing the impact of exposure to violence on children. They can help children by creating a predictable environment, listening to students’ stories, and assuring children and adolescents that whatever happened was not their fault. Teachers don’t have to do it alone! The abuse or maltreatment of children is against the law. Victims and survivors need an effective child protective service to prevent them from suffering further injury. Call NYS Child Protective Services at 1-800-342-3720. It can be difficult to see the red flags in an abusive relationship. These are some signs to watch out for: 🚩 If your partner always wants to be with you and won't let you be alone 🚩 If they often make you doubt your own thoughts and feelings 🚩 They might act really nice after being mean, trying to confuse you and make you stay. 🚩 If the relationship keeps breaking up and getting back together a lot It's important to understand these signs so you can help yourself or others who might be stuck in a bad situation. Recognizing the signs of child abuse. Here are some common indicators that might signal abuse is happening: ➡️ Unexplained Injuries: Frequent or unexplained bruises, burns, or fractures can be a red flag. Pay attention to patterns or repeated injuries. ➡️ Behavioral Changes: Sudden changes in behavior, such as withdrawal, aggression, or anxiety, may indicate that a child is experiencing abuse. ➡️ Fear of Certain Adults: A child who shows an unusual fear of a particular adult or avoids going home may be trying to avoid an abusive situation. ➡️ Regressive Behaviors: A child may revert to earlier behaviors, such as bedwetting or thumb-sucking, as a response to trauma. ➡️ Academic Decline: A sudden drop in school performance or lack of interest in schoolwork can be a sign that a child is dealing with something traumatic at home. It is important to remember that these signs don’t always indicate child abuse but should be a red flag that raises a concern. If you notice one or more of these signals take the steps to address it right away.
